عنوان انگلیسی مقاله ISI
Oxidation behaviour of zirconium hydride and its influence on the thermal desorption kinetics

چکیده انگلیسی
The oxidation kinetics of zirconium hydride powder in air was studied over the temperature range of 100-300 °C. The oxidation kinetic parameters were obtained and a controlling mechanism was proposed. The XPS depth profile analysis was consistent with a layered structure of the oxide film. The evolution of oxygen concentration profile allowed to estimate the diffusion coefficient of oxygen in zirconium oxide. Thermal desorption behaviours of pre-oxidized ZrH2 were studied using simultaneous thermogravimetry and thermal desorption spectroscopy (TG-TDS). The phase transformation sequence during dehydrogenation process of pre-oxidized ZrH2 was established and a corresponding shrinking core model was proposed.
